It was a night to forget for Titus O'Neil
Titus O'Neil entered The Greatest Royal Rumble at number 39 but it seems that the leader of Titus Worldwide decided to make one of the most memorable entrances of the night when he tripped on the entrance ramp and flew underneath the ring.
